Knights Templar delivers stable performance for intermediate growers. It averages 20 to 24 percent THC with low CBD and flowers in eight to nine weeks. The plant stays medium in height and responds well to training techniques. You will harvest dense, resinous buds suitable for day or evening use. Knights Templar Strain Information and Characteristics
-
Strain TypeStrain Type:
Knights Templar is an indica-dominant hybrid built for balance and structure. You will see compact colas and steady development.
-
THC ContentTHC Content:
Knights Templar tests around 20 to 24 percent THC. You should prepare for potent effects at common doses.
-
CBD ContentCBD Content:
CBD remains low at about 0.5 to 1 percent. Medical users report useful symptom relief despite modest CBD.
-
Grow DifficultyGrow Difficulty:
This strain suits intermediate growers who manage pruning and feeding. You will need routine training for top bud production.
-
Flowering TimeFlowering Time:
Flowering runs about eight to nine weeks indoors. Outdoor harvest usually arrives in early October under long seasons.
-
Expected YieldExpected Yield:
Indoor yields sit in the medium-high range at roughly 400 to 500 grams per square meter. BC and other growers report solid outdoor weights in long seasons.
-
Plant HeightPlant Height:
Plants stay medium in height, typically 80 to 140 centimeters. You can train them effectively in limited headroom setups.
-
Growing EnvironmentGrowing Environment:
Knights Templar performs well under controlled indoor lighting. It also holds up outdoors in warm, temperate climates.
-
Expected EffectsExpected Effects:
Effects lean toward relaxed focus with a steady uplift. You should expect calm that supports daytime tasks or evening wind-down.
-
Genetic LineageGenetic Lineage:
Genetics read Templar Kush x White Knight. The cross produces stable structure and reliable resin.
-
Seed TypeSeed Type:
These seeds are feminized to deliver predictable female plants. You avoid male removal in mixed batches.
-
Preferred ClimatePreferred Climate:
Best climate runs temperate to Mediterranean with long sun periods. In cooler Canadian regions start plants indoors early.

Q: My plants stretch too much after flip. What now?
A: Cut top growth before flip and apply low stress training early to control height.

Q: Leaves show tip burn during flower. Help?
A: Reduce feed strength and check runoff pH. Flush once if salts spike.

Q: How to improve resin production?
A: Keep stable humidity, add late bloom PK boost and avoid heavy nitrogen late in flower.

Q: What trellis method works best?
A: Use a horizontal trellis or SCROG to spread the canopy and increase bud sites.
